To learn more about these vulnerabilities, see Microsoft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ures CVE-2017-8631, CVE-2017-8632, and CVE-2017-8742. This security update resolves vulnerabilities in Microsoft Office that could allow remote code execution if a user opens a specially crafted Office file. and Microsoft Office for Mac Academic 2011.Microsoft Office for Mac Home and Student 2011.It includes fixes for vulnerabilities that an attacker can use to overwrite the contents of your computer's memory with malicious code. This update fixes critical issues and also helps to improve security.Note: The downloadable file is a security update for the Microsoft Office 2011 package Note: This product is not compatible with macOS Catalina and later.
